Apache thrift

Définition - Que signifie Apache Thrift?

Apache Thrift est un outil open-source de l'Apache Software Foundation qui permet de fournir un support et des solutions multilingues pour les systèmes de code «polyglottes».

Les concepteurs d'Apache Thrift l'appellent un outil de "développement de services multilingues évolutif". D'autres pourraient l'appeler une «plate-forme de sérialisation» ou une «ressource de support multilingue». Apache Thrift se compose d'une pile logicielle et d'un moteur de génération de code qui aident à fournir différents types de support pour l'ingénierie multilingue.

Definir Tech explique Apache Thrift

Une partie des fonctionnalités d'Apache Thrift est que les développeurs peuvent modifier les transports ou les protocoles sans recompiler un projet. Les experts pourraient décrire cela comme un plan de normalisation des modules pour une utilisation multilingue ou comme un cadre général pour les services réseau. Apache Thrift peut également fonctionner avec des serveurs d'appel de procédure à distance (RPC) pour prendre en charge les projets de mise en réseau.

En général, Apache Thrift aide les entreprises à faire face à des situations où les systèmes polyglottes ont rendu l'administration générale difficile. Même les entreprises qui se sont engagées à utiliser un seul langage logiciel pour le développement ont généralement des bits d'autres langages de programmation inclus dans divers aspects de leur architecture informatique. Apache Thrift peut aider à combler le fossé lorsque les ingénieurs doivent entrer et faire en sorte que ces différents modules se parlent.